Under FCI regulations, the breed now known in both the UK and the USA as the Griffon Bruxellois is divided into three separate breeds, which are the Griffon Beige, the Griffon Bruxellois and the Petit Brabancon. All three types of dog are classified within FCI Group 9.
The Belgian Griffon is black or black and tan with long, wiry hair. The dog was bred with English Toy Spaniels to reduce its size. The Griffon Bruxellois, also known as the Brussels griffon, has a harsh, wiry, coat of clear red, which is longer than the Belgian Griffon's and is perhaps the most familiar in the UK. The third variation, the Petit Brabancon, can be red, black, or black and tan, and has a short, tight coat. It has a Pug like face with semi-erect ears. |
